Impalas (Aepyceros melampus) found dead in Kruger National Park, South Africa, had elevated concentrations of copper in livers (maximum 444 mg/kg FW) and kidneys (maximum 141 mg/kg FW) authors assert that copper poisoning is the most likely cause of death (Gummow et al. 1991), but this needs verification. Copper concentrations in bones, kidneys, and livers of white-tailed deer (Odocoileus virginianus) near a copper smelter and from distant sites are about the same. However, deer near the smelter have significantly elevated concentrations of cadmium in kidneys and livers, lead in bone, and zinc in kidneys (Storm et al. 1994). [Pg.170]

C. Adult males, i, in response to other males Bulls rarely exhibit flehmen to non-musth male urine (Rasmussen et al., 1984)(Figure 5). Bulls exhibit flehmen frequently in response to their own urine during musth and to the musth urine of other bulls. From October 1983 to April 1985 36 flehmens to male musth urine were recorded. Male temporal gland secretions (musth) also elicited flehmen responses (Rasmussen et al., 1984).
